APPLICATION LETTER

Berkmar High School
405 Pleasant Hill Rd
Lilburn, GA 30078
March 20, 2006

Mr. Ken Johnson
Principal of Berkmar

Dear Mr. Johnson:

I am writing to apply for the cafeteria job advertised in The Atlanta Journal.  I am a high school student and will be graduating next year.  In addition, I have the skills and experience you need in the school cafeteria.
Recently, I have been helping my mother in our family restaurant.  I have also assisted our cook in the kitchen.  Moreover, I have been serving as a waiter (a boy)/ a waitress.  Therefore, I have acquired the secret of serving the public.  I am hard-working, flexible and dependable.  If you hire me, I will do my best to increase productivity in the cafeteria.
Thank you for accepting my application, and I look forward to working for you.

Sincerely,
Josephine Haba

CHECK LIST OF ANEMPLOYMENT APPLICATION LETTER

How do you write an application letter?
1. Write your address and the date on the upper right as shown in the application letter above.
2. make two or three spaces.  Then write the inside address; that is the name and address of the employer as shown in the application letter above.
3. The greetings, as shown above.
4. In the opening paragraph, you need to explain why you are writing, and why the employer should pay a particular attention to your application as shown in the letter above.
5. In the second paragraph, you should describe your skills and experiences as shown in the application letter above.
6. In the closing paragraph, you need to thank the person you are writing, and you need to mention your desire to working for him/her as shown above.
7. Complementary – Sincerely.
8. Your signature
9. Your name
